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(280)

Side by Side Diff: third_party/scons/scons-local/SCons/Tool/c++.py

Issue 17024: Update to SCons 1.2.0. (Closed) Base URL: svn://chrome-svn/chrome/trunk/src/
Patch Set: '' Created 11 years, 11 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ch | Annotate | Revision Log
OLDNEW
1 """SCons.Tool.c++ 1 """SCons.Tool.c++
2 2
3 Tool-specific initialization for generic Posix C++ compilers. 3 Tool-specific initialization for generic Posix C++ compilers.
4 4
5 There normally shouldn't be any need to import this module directly. 5 There normally shouldn't be any need to import this module directly.
6 It will usually be imported through the generic SCons.Tool.Tool() 6 It will usually be imported through the generic SCons.Tool.Tool()
7 selection method. 7 selection method.
8 """ 8 """
9 9
10 # 10 #
(...skipping 12 matching lines...) Expand all
23 # 23 #
24 # TH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Y 24 # TH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Y
25 # K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E 25 # K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E
26 # W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ND 26 # W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ND
27 # N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S OR COPYRIGHT HOLDERS BE 27 # N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S OR COPYRIGHT HOLDERS BE
28 # L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ION 28 # L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ION
29 # O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ION 29 # O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ION
30 # W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. 30 # W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
31 # 31 #
32 32
33 __revision__ = "src/engine/SCons/Tool/c++.py 3603 2008/10/10 05:46:45 scons" 33 __revision__ = "src/engine/SCons/Tool/c++.py 3842 2008/12/20 22:59:52 scons"
34 34
35 import os.path 35 import os.path
36 36
37 import SCons.Tool 37 import SCons.Tool
38 import SCons.Defaults 38 import SCons.Defaults
39 import SCons.Util 39 import SCons.Util
40 40
41 compilers = ['CC', 'c++'] 41 compilers = ['CC', 'c++']
42 42
43 CXXSuffixes = ['.cpp', '.cc', '.cxx', '.c++', '.C++', '.mm'] 43 CXXSuffixes = ['.cpp', '.cc', '.cxx', '.c++', '.C++', '.mm']
(...skipping 40 matching lines...) Expand 10 before | Expand all | Expand 10 after
84 env['INCPREFIX'] = '-I' 84 env['INCPREFIX'] = '-I'
85 env['INCSUFFIX'] = '' 85 env['INCSUFFIX'] = ''
86 env['SHOBJSUFFIX'] = '.os' 86 env['SHOBJSUFFIX'] = '.os'
87 env['OBJSUFFIX'] = '.o' 87 env['OBJSUFFIX'] = '.o'
88 env['STATIC_AND_SHARED_OBJECTS_ARE_THE_SAME'] = 0 88 env['STATIC_AND_SHARED_OBJECTS_ARE_THE_SAME'] = 0
89 89
90 env['CXXFILESUFFIX'] = '.cc' 90 env['CXXFILESUFFIX'] = '.cc'
91 91
92 def exists(env): 92 def exists(env):
93 return env.Detect(compilers) 93 return env.Detect(compilers)
OLDNEW
« no previous file with comments | « third_party/scons/scons-local/SCons/Tool/bcc32.py ('k') | third_party/scons/scons-local/SCons/Tool/cc.py »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698